Comida Deluxe Recipe

Inspired by Chuy's
Time1h
Serves6

Cheese enchiladas with Tex-Mex Sauce, chicken flautas, a crispy taco, guacamole & homemade tostada chips dipped in queso.

Method

Preparation Instructions

  1. 1

    Prepare the Enchiladas

    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). In a skillet, heat some oil and lightly fry each corn tortilla until soft. Remove tortillas and fill each with shredded cheese and cooked chicken, then roll them up tightly. Place in a baking dish seam-side down.

  2. 2

    Make the Tex-Mex Sauce

    In a saucepan, combine 1 cup of water, taco seasoning, and any additional spices to taste. Bring to a simmer and pour over the enchiladas in the baking dish. Top with remaining cheese.

  3. 3

    Bake the Enchiladas

    Cover the baking dish with foil and bake for 20 minutes. Remove foil and bake for an additional 10 minutes until cheese is bubbly and golden.

  4. 4

    Prepare the Flautas

    In the same skillet, add more oil if necessary. Fill each tortilla with shredded chicken, roll tightly, and fry until golden brown and crispy. Remove and drain on paper towels.

  5. 5

    Make the Tostada Chips

    Cut corn tortillas into quarters and fry in hot oil until golden and crispy. Drain on paper towels and season with salt.

  6. 6

    Assemble the Plate

    On a large platter, arrange the enchiladas, flautas, crispy taco (filled with ground beef, lettuce, and tomato), guacamole, sour cream, and queso dip. Serve with tostada chips.
